Jörg Steck - Promisses of Belief and Hope
The role of so-called globalisation has achieved widespread dominance especially since the collapse of the Soviet Union and its satellite states. Although the ominous meaning of the rather overused general term still remains vague, its effects are usually quite tangible, as the world's greatest economic and financial crisis since the Second World War currently demonstrates.
